Part of the terms of Leader Pelosi maintaining her minority leader position was that they allow some younger members of the caucus into leadership roles. Weiner was one such member. So the leadership was understandably peeved that while he was representing them in public he was pulling this stuff behind the scenes.

I still don’t think they should have yanked the rug out from under him. But this at least partially explains why the leadership was so pissed.
